Further smplify pawn endgames
Dumb down a bit the code and trade some possible speed (but this is far from hot path anyhow) for some added readability for the layman. No functional change.

// Map the square as if strongSide is white and strongSide's only pawn
|
||||
// is on the left half of the board.
|
||||
Square normalize(const Position& pos, Color strongSide, Square sq) {
|
||||
|
||||
assert(pos.count<PAWN>(strongSide) == 1);
|
||||
|
||||
if (file_of(pos.list<PAWN>(strongSide)[0]) >= FILE_E)
|
||||
sq = mirror(sq);
|
||||
|
||||
if (strongSide == BLACK)
|
||||
sq = ~sq;
|
||||
|
||||
return sq;
|
||||
}
